To be especially noticeable or easily recognized because of a particular quality, feature, or reason.
الاستخدام والفروق الدقيقة
This is a phrasal verb used to describe what makes something noticeable among others, often followed by the reason or quality after 'for'. Common phrases: 'stand out for your honesty', 'stand out for innovation'. It is used in both formal and informal contexts.
